What is ISO 37001?
ISO 37001:2016 is a standard developed by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) that specifies requirements for an anti-bribery management system. It helps organizations implement effective anti-bribery controls to prevent, detect, and address bribery within their operations. This standard applies to all types of organizations, regardless of their size, sector, or geographical location.
ISO 37001 requires organizations to establish policies and procedures that help prevent bribery, conduct risk assessments, create internal controls, and foster a culture of compliance. It also requires monitoring and auditing to ensure the system is working effectively.
Why ISO 37001 Training is Important
ISO 37001 training is crucial for organizations aiming to establish a robust anti-bribery program that not only complies with international regulations but also fosters a culture of transparency and ethical business practices. By educating employees and management on the principles of ISO 37001, organizations can:
Prevent Corruption: ISO 37001 training equips employees with the knowledge and skills to identify potential bribery risks and understand how to avoid unethical behavior.
Ensure Compliance: Organizations subject to national and international anti-bribery laws, such as the UK Bribery Act or the U.S. Foreign Corrupt Practices Act, can use ISO 37001 to demonstrate their commitment to legal compliance.
Reputation Management: By actively preventing bribery and unethical practices, organizations can protect their brand reputation and build trust with stakeholders, including clients, partners, and regulators.
Reduce Legal and Financial Risks: Non-compliance with anti-corruption laws can result in severe legal and financial consequences. ISO 37001 training helps mitigate these risks by ensuring employees are aware of their responsibilities and the consequences of corruption.

Key Topics Covered in ISO 37001 Training
Anti-Bribery Management System (ABMS): Understanding the key components and structure of an effective ABMS, as outlined in ISO 37001.
Bribery Risk Assessment: How to identify, assess, and mitigate the risks associated with bribery and corruption.
Leadership Commitment: The importance of senior management's role in setting the tone at the top and creating a culture of compliance.
Preventive Measures: Developing policies, procedures, and controls to prevent bribery, including employee training, third-party due diligence, and internal audits.
Monitoring and Auditing: The ongoing process of evaluating and improving the anti-bribery management system to ensure its effectiveness.
